Subject: Chipline cut-over complete

Hi — quick summary before you review the PR. We moved the Chipline timing-chip reader off the legacy ingest path last night during the Fernvale Marathon dry run. All mats reported cleanly, and dedupe latency stayed under 40 ms. The old poller is disabled but not yet removed; that cleanup is in a follow-up branch. The new service reads its settings at startup, and the full set of configuration values is listed below.

service settings:
OLIATH_HOST=oliath.tolvaqlabs.internal
OLIATH_PORT=6379

### Support sync notes — digest scheduling

Quick recap for the support crew: the Pigeonwire batch email digests are moving from a fixed 6 a.m. send to per-timezone scheduling next week. Expect a few tickets from folks whose digest shows up at a new hour — that's intended, not a bug. Duplicate digests, though, are a real defect; tag those tickets "digest-dupe." Anything weird beyond that, don't guess — escalate. All digest-scheduling escalations now go to one person, listed below.

approver of yajef-fajef = Oliwyn Silion Kasok Kasox

Subject: Visitor handling — updated procedure

Hello facilities team,

A reminder of the visitor process at the Wrexfield Point front desk. Every visitor must be pre-registered by their host, shown the safety notice, and issued a dated lanyard before going beyond the barrier. Unescorted visitors are not permitted past reception under any circumstances, and lanyards must be collected on departure. When covering the desk, you will need access to the visitor badge drawer, which opens with the code below.

door code, yagap-bahof: bdg-O-05

## Step 3: Migrate the Givenhart receipt mailer

Receipts now render server-side; the old client template endpoint is removed. Verify the mailer runs under the restricted service account and that PII fields are masked in logs. Audit queries against receipt_ledger must use read-only credentials. The mailer reaches the ledger via the connection string below.

primary connection of tajeg-tajop = postgresql://julax_svc:DI@db-e7f3.kelvidyn.corp:5432/rusdor